As there are several choices when looking for dermal fillers that are right for you, there are a few things to consider when making your choice.

Dermal fillers vary from one to the another in a variety of ways. One of those ways is composition, i.e. what it's made of. For instance, some dermal fillers are made of collagen, while others are made of hyaluronic acid or other materials. Examples of dermal fillers containing collagen include Evolence (porcine, or pig, collagen), Cosmoplast and Cosmoderm (human collagen) and Artefill (bovine, or cow, collagen). Dermal fillers made of hyaluronic acid include JUVEDERM ?, Restylane, Perlane and Prevelle Silk. Sculptra is made of poly lactic acid, while Radiesse is made of calcium hydroxyl apatite.

One of the more obvious considerations when looking into dermal fillers is the possible uses of each option. JUVEDERM ?, Restylane and Perlane are used in the nasolabial folds, lips, cheeks and around the mouth. Radiesse may be used in the nasolabial folds, temples and cheeks, but may not be used in the lips. Sculptra is used to provide general facial volume in the cheeks, chin or temple, while Cosmoplast and Cosmoderm may be used to treat the nasolabial folds, lips or fine lines. Artefill may not be used in the lips, but may be a good option for use in the nasolabial folds, chin or cheeks.

Another major consideration is how long the results of each dermal filler last. For some, the results may last between six months and a year (JUVEDERM ?, Restylane, Perlane, Radiesse and Evolence), although treatment in the lips with some of these dermal fillers (JUVEDERM ? and Restylane) may last just three to six months. Prevelle Silk, Cosmoplast and Cosmoderm results may last just two to six months, while Sculptra may last two to four years and Artefill may last for five or more years.

Generally, the longer the results last, the more expensive the procedure will be. For instance, Artefill and Sculptra tend to be two of the more expensive options, but have results that last for multiple years. Options whose results last between six months and a year are somewhere in the middle of the price range, while those with results that last just two to six months are cheaper options in many cases. Prices may vary from one clinic to the next, however.
